#3fbb40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fbb40 is composed of 24.7% red, 73.3%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.8%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 120.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 49%. #3fbb40 color hex could be obtained by blending #7eff80 with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#3fbb40 color description : Moderate lime green.
#3fbb40 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3fbb40 has RGB values of R:63, G:187,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4176704.

Shades and Tints of #3fbb40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3fbb40
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798179 is the less saturated color, while #05f507 is the most saturated one.
